## Immutable Settlement Logic

Immutable Settlement Logic refers to the permanent and unchangeable rules embedded within a blockchain protocol that govern how trades are finalized. Once a transaction is broadcast and confirmed, the code dictates the transfer of assets, and this action cannot be reversed by any authority.

This provides a high degree of certainty for participants in financial derivatives, as the settlement outcome is guaranteed by the network's consensus. It removes the need for clearinghouses or manual dispute resolution.

The logic is transparent and verifiable by anyone auditing the protocol code. It serves as the bedrock of trust in decentralized trading environments.
